RBMH differentiation

  • The key RBMH question is not 'can software automatically approve an invoice?' — Intuit publicly says it can.
  • The stronger distinction is whether a system can establish that the expenditure itself should be authorised in response to an expenditure request, based upon authenticated identity and predictive financial state, before committing to the transaction.

Strategic significance

  • Enterprise Suite is the most advanced publicly evidenced Intuit automation of the approval layer, and therefore the hardest test of RBMH differentiation.
